You could spend your free time drawing/practicing on your artwork in a doodle book or a clipboard full of printer paper. Each picture will be better than the last. You could also watch some anime speed draws to give you some ideas on detail and shading. I did all the following and I'm an anime artist today. Don't give up, you're going to do great! :)

My advice to you is that you could try starting off with the basics, like just practicing different eyes, noses, mouths, hairstyles etc.
You could always watch tutorials or borrow books on how to draw body parts in the right proportions and on angles.

It's perfectly fine as a cartoony-style drawing but if it's a slightly more realistic style, there are a few problems with proportions. The shape of the head looks a little off. I suggest looking up drawing tutorials on the internet about the shape of the head.

The best teacher is always experience. Keep practicing and drawing during your free-time and in no time you'll be a lot better. Don't be discouraged when it seems your newest drawing looks worse than the last. Things like that happen sometimes(based from experience), and it just means that it's not your day.
